Charter Research & Investment Group Inc. Sells 1,762 Shares of Bristol-Myers Squibb (NYSE:BMY)

Charter Research & Investment Group Inc. lowered its stake in Bristol-Myers Squibb (NYSE:BMYFree Report) by 4.3% in the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The institutional investor owned 39,658 shares of the biopharmaceutical company’s stock after selling 1,762 shares during the period. Bristol-Myers Squibb accounts for 1.7% of Charter Research & Investment Group Inc.’s portfolio, making the stock its 19th largest position. Charter Research & Investment Group Inc.’s holdings in Bristol-Myers Squibb were worth $2,243,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C).

Bristol-Myers Squibb Company Profile

(Free Report)

Bristol-Myers Squibb Company discovers, develops, licenses, manufactures, markets, distributes, and sells biopharmaceutical products worldwide. It offers products for hematology, oncology, cardiovascular, immunology, fibrotic, and neuroscience diseases. The company's products include Eliquis for reduction in risk of stroke/systemic embolism in non-valvular atrial fibrillation, and for the treatment of DVT/PE; Opdivo for various anti-cancer indications, including bladder, blood, CRC, head and neck, RCC, HCC, lung, melanoma, MPM, stomach and esophageal cancer; Pomalyst/Imnovid for multiple myeloma; Orencia for active rheumatoid arthritis and psoriatic arthritis; and Sprycel for the treatment of Philadelphia chromosome-positive chronic myeloid leukemia.
